Atlantis Computing has completed a $20 million Series D financing round led by new investor Adams Street Partners. Previous investors Cisco Systems, El Dorado Ventures and Partech International also participated in the financing, continuing their commitment to Atlantis Computing. The funding will be used to support the company's worldwide expansion.
